Output 670852b1b486c3428e3599f18e245f2b23c6e2a9670e754da18d80d351574aea:2

value
28560079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ff8b3801ab32dbba721f7133ae4846071a8ec062 OP_EQUAL
address
MXCMKSJUMQnhUftjfLcMEe8T4su3C8aSzN
transaction
670852b1b486c3428e3599f18e245f2b23c6e2a9670e754da18d80d351574aea
spent
true